PROBLEM TO BE SOLVED: To obtain complex particles soluble in living bodies capable of being used for drug delivery systems and adjuvants by coating a calcium phosphate- based compound having absorbing property on particles of a high molecular weight material soluble in living bodies. SOLUTION: The complex particles soluble in living bodies are obtained by coating (A) the surface of particles of a high molecular weight material soluble in living bodies (preferably gelatin, polylactic acid, chitin, polyvinyl alcohol, polyacrylic acid, collagen) with (B) a calcium phosphate-based compound having 1.0-2.0Ca/P ratio (preferably hydroxy apatite having 1.65-1.67Ca/P ratio). The particles preferably consist of the component A and component B, a part of which penetrates in the component A. The component A is preferably consists of particles having 1-20μm average particle size in a particle distribution range of d75 /d25 <=2. The obtained complex particles preferably have 1.2-30.0μm average particle size in the above mentioned particle distribution, 1.05-1.35g/cm<3> density, 500-1,000Åpore size and 0.1-5.0μm thickness of the component B. |
